Mike Nesmith’s Wealth: A Music and Business Success Story

Mike Nesmith, another member of The Monkees, had a significantly higher net worth of $50 million at the time of his passing. This wealth was built upon his music career with The Monkees, shrewd business ventures, and inherited wealth.
